(iphone) получить доступ к каталогу документов устройства с Mac? - PullRequest
47 голосов
/ 31 марта 2011

Я пытаюсь получить доступ к каталогу документов на устройстве iphone, чтобы увидеть файл журнала, который я сохранил при запуске приложения.

Я знаю, что это можно сделать для симулятора. (вы можете просматривать каталог документов вашего приложения с помощью Finder)

Можно ли это сделать для устройства?

Спасибо

Ответы [ 7 ]

52 голосов
/ 24 сентября 2014

В Xcode 6 вы должны открыть окно Устройства, чтобы загрузить его.

enter image description here

48 голосов
/ 23 августа 2011

Вы можете открыть Органайзер в Xcode и скачать каталог документов, когда ваше устройство подключено, верно?

17 голосов
/ 15 января 2013

Привет, ответ Viraj - это путь. Вот скриншот: enter image description here

15 голосов
/ 13 августа 2015

Я собираюсь объединить два решения вместе и добавить скриншоты для ясности. Это с Xcode 7 .

Просмотр / загрузка документов приложения

  1. Откройте окно Устройства через меню Window -> Devices.
  2. Выберите ваше устройство.
  3. Выберите приложение.
  4. Нажмите кнопку передач для выбора вариантов.

View/Download Documents

Просмотр / Загрузка / Удаление документов через iTunes


ВАЖНО !!!
Если у вас есть документы в подпапке, вы не сможете просматривать или изменять их через iTunes .


  1. Выберите файл Info.plist в навигаторе проекта .
  2. Нажмите кнопку + рядом с любым свойством, чтобы добавить другое.
  3. Прокрутите список вниз или введите, чтобы найти Application supports iTunes file sharing.
  4. Измените логическое значение на YES.
  5. Пересборка / установка приложения.

Add file sharing support

10 голосов
/ 31 марта 2011

iOS предоставляет платформу для обмена документами между вашим приложением и iTunes. Ознакомьтесь с разделом Core Services Layer документации Apple, в частности с разделом Поддержка общего доступа к файлам . Это объясняет, как это сделать:

  1. Добавьте ключ UIFileSharingEnabled в файл Info.plist вашего приложения и установите для него значение YES.
  2. Поместите все файлы, которыми вы хотите поделиться, в каталог документов вашего приложения.

В дополнение к этому, если это только для отладки, вы всегда можете распечатать журналы, используя функцию NSLog по умолчанию, и проверить вывод, используя Консоль OS X .

7 голосов
/ 13 сентября 2013

Вы также можете использовать itunes для того же, но для просмотра в itunes внесите изменения, как показано ниже в вашем .plist Добавьте новый ключ как «Приложение поддерживает общий доступ к файлам iTunes» и сделайте его буленом со значением YES

Like this

0 голосов
/ 25 сентября 2017

Одним из способов может быть использование iExplorer Ссылка для скачивания iExplorer

Go to your app and Documents folder can be seen

...